Electronic devices such as smartphones, laptops, and tablets often come equipped with access control features to protect personal data and prevent unauthorized users from gaining entry. These systems may include passwords, biometric authentication, or even two-factor authentication to ensure a high level of security. In embedded systems like smart locks, access control is essential for granting access to authorized individuals while keeping intruders at bay. For parents, access control can be a powerful tool for ensuring children's safety in a digital age. By setting up parental controls on devices and restricting access to certain websites or apps, parents can protect their children from potentially harmful content or interactions online. Additionally, access control features on smart home devices can help parents monitor and control their children's activities, such as limiting screen time or regulating access to certain rooms in the house. When it comes to parenting tips and advice related to access control, communication is key. Parents should have open and honest conversations with their children about the importance of online safety and the reasons behind setting up access controls. By involving children in the decision-making process and explaining the purpose of these controls, parents can help them understand the importance of staying safe online. Another important tip is to regularly review and update access control settings to adapt to the changing needs of both parents and children. As children grow and their digital habits evolve, parents may need to adjust access controls accordingly to ensure continued safety and security. It's also important for parents to stay informed about the latest trends and technologies in access control to make informed decisions about their children's online activities.
